Output 431215156176ed164fb478a0e2c71d9e28fb46bb650b71734ed2fa369e6893de:14

value
9916115
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 be62ba6cd308074d29879f11329cb9f774c60dcdd3f0ccf67344f0dd1265ae96
address
tb1phe3t5mxnpqr562v8nugn989e7a6vvrwd60cveanngncd6yn946tq3wnvhe
transaction
431215156176ed164fb478a0e2c71d9e28fb46bb650b71734ed2fa369e6893de
confirmations
33748
spent
true